The University of Washington (UW), one of the world's preeminent universities, invites applications and nominations for the position of Associate Vice President for Financial Enterprise Operations.
The Associate Vice President for Financial Enterprise Operations is a senior leadership position responsible for overall leadership for units within UW Finance that provides business services, including tax, procurement, public records/meetings, DATAGroup, records management, and Creative Communications (print/copy/mailing centers/web support) University-wide. Additional units may be assigned to the AVP, including merchant services, payroll, and other enterprise business services units.
This position plays a key leadership role, both within UW Finance and the University of Washington. This position is responsible for building external relationships with regulatory agencies and vendors, along with fostering strong internal relationships and partnerships with University Administrators across three campuses and the UW Medical Centers to ensure enterprise systems and policy management of business services.
The Associate Vice President for Financial Enterprise Operations will have an exciting role in providing both operational expertise and strategic vision for this unit. While leading the work of approximately 180 staff, with varying levels of responsibility/positions, responsible for highly regulated and high-volume activities, in an environment that is ever-changing. While leadership and team management is a significant role for this position there is also Program Development, Management, Administration, and Policy Development.
